diff options
Diffstat (limited to 'jimfs/src/main')
-rw-r--r-- | jimfs/src/main/java/com/google/jimfs/internal/DirectoryTable.java | 8 |
1 files changed, 2 insertions, 6 deletions
diff --git a/jimfs/src/main/java/com/google/jimfs/internal/DirectoryTable.java b/jimfs/src/main/java/com/google/jimfs/internal/DirectoryTable.java index 45570f2..f9b953d 100644 --- a/jimfs/src/main/java/com/google/jimfs/internal/DirectoryTable.java +++ b/jimfs/src/main/java/com/google/jimfs/internal/DirectoryTable.java @@ -170,17 +170,13 @@ final class DirectoryTable implements FileContent { } } - @SuppressWarnings("unchecked") // safe cast - private static final Ordering<Name> ORDERING_BY_STRING = - (Ordering<Name>) (Ordering) Ordering.usingToString(); - /** * Creates an immutable sorted snapshot of the names this directory contains, excluding "." and * "..". */ - @SuppressWarnings("unchecked") // safe cast public ImmutableSortedSet<Name> snapshot() { - ImmutableSortedSet.Builder<Name> builder = ImmutableSortedSet.orderedBy(ORDERING_BY_STRING); + ImmutableSortedSet.Builder<Name> builder = + new ImmutableSortedSet.Builder<>(Ordering.usingToString()); for (DirectoryEntry entry : entries()) { if (!isReserved(entry.name())) { |